Address

ecash:qpg8a4vxnpd9rnvprcw4utjrquxge3g07cn7gmde82Copy

Total Received

12890000 XEC

Total Sent

12890000 XEC

№ Transactions

62

Final Balance

0 XEC

Transactions
Filter